What values do you hold and want to pass down to your child? Honesty, respect, compassion, dependability might be on that list, which may seem easier said than done. Here are some ways to help instill values in your children.
Volunteering / Helping your Community
Teach your children the obligation to help others. Volunteering as a family shows children the importance of giving back and creates meaningful shared experiences.
Be a Positive Example at Home
Show kindness and avoid negative comments. Children learn more from what they see than what they are told. Model the behaviour you want to see in your children.
Show Respect
Model respect toward elders and authority figures. Teach manners like saying “thank you” and “please.” Respectful children grow into respectful adults.
Use Media to Reinforce Positive Values

Generations Change
Acknowledge the reality of social media and the changing world. Point out teachable moments when they arise and use them as opportunities for discussion.
